Read more info about customs on the official NZ customs website.Different postage prices apply to postcards, letters, large envelopes (flats), and parcels. In general, the bigger your mailpiece, the more it will cost to mail. In First-Class Mail, postcards cost less than letters. Letter size mail costs less than flat-size mail. Parcels pay the highest price due to the cost of processing and delivery.

Sending a postcard overseas will set you back only NZ$3.30. Sending a medium letter (130mm x 235mm x 6mm) cost NZ$3.30 to Australia and NZ$4.00 to the rest of the world. Sending a large letter (165mm x 235mm x 10mm) cost NZ$4.00 to Australia and NZ$4.60 to the rest of the world. Correios de Portugal (CTT) is the main centralized postal service in Portugal. For nearly 500 years, it was a state-run company. However, in 2011, an agreement was signed with the European troika to privatize it. The deal was implemented in two stages and completed three years later, in 2014.Initial United States postage rates were set by Congress as part of the Postal Service Act signed into law by President George Washington on February 20, 1792. Advertisement Help kids develop writing skills with pen pal activities for kids. From wri...For Italian addresses: The recipient’s surname is usually written before the first name. The door number is usually stated after the street name on the second line. The postcode is stated first on the third line, followed by the town, then the two-letter abbreviation of the province. Please write 'ITALY' in capital letters on the last line of ...
